Assessing Storm Damage: The First Step

After a storm hits, assessing any potential damage should be your top priority. Qualified roofers can conduct a thorough inspection of your roof's integrity.

Signs of Storm Damage to Look For

Missing or damaged shingles Leaks inside your home Granules from shingles in gutters Visible cracks or holes

Roof Replacement vs. Repair: When Is It Time?

Factors Influencing Your Decision

Sometimes repairing isn’t enough; knowing when it's time for a complete replacement can save you money and headaches in the long run.

Key Indicators for Replacement Include:

Age of the Roof (typically over 20 years) Extent of Damage Frequency of Repairs Needed

Cost Considerations for Replacement vs Repair

| Factor | Repair Cost Estimate | Replacement Cost Estimate | |---------------------|----------------------|---------------------------| | Minor Repairs | $300 - $800 | N/A | | Major Repairs | $1,000 - $3,000 | N/A | | Full Replacement | N/A | $7,000 - $15,000 |

Choosing the Right Roofing Materials: A Comprehensive Guide

Fort Worth roofers offer various materials suited for different styles and budgets:

Asphalt Shingles Metal Roofing Tile Roofing Slate Roofing

Pros and Cons of Each Material

Asphalt Shingles

Pros: Affordable, easy installation

Cons: Shorter lifespan compared to other options

Metal Roofing

Pros: Durable, energy-efficient

Cons: Higher initial cost

Tile Roofing

Pros: Long-lasting, adds aesthetic value

Cons: Heavier; may require additional structural support

Understanding Your Coverage Options

After assessing storm damage comes the often daunting task of filing insurance claims. Knowing what coverage you have can significantly ease this process.

Common Types of Coverage Available:

Dwelling Coverage Personal Property Coverage Additional Living Expenses (ALE)

Tips for Filing Claims Successfully

Document All Damages with Photos Keep Receipts for Temporary Repairs Work with Experienced Roofers Familiar with Insurance Processes

The Importance of Regular Roof Maintenance

Why Regular Maintenance Matters?

Just like any part of your home, roofs require regular upkeep to maintain their integrity.

Benefits of Regular Maintenance Include:

Early Detection of Issues Extended Lifespan Improved Energy Efficiency

Maintenance Tips from Local Roofers

Clean Gutters Regularly Inspect Flashing and Seals Schedule Professional Inspections Annually

How long does it take to replace a roof?

Typically between 1 day to several weeks depending on size and complexity.

Will my insurance cover all damages?

It depends on your policy; consult with an insurance agent for specifics regarding coverage limits.

How often should I have my roof inspected?

At least once a year or after severe weather events.

Can I perform my own roof repairs?

While minor fixes are possible, hiring professionals ensures safety and adherence to local building codes.

What type of roofing material lasts longest?

Slate and metal roofs generally offer longer lifespans compared to asphalt shingles.
